Transaction 3393624810d8b6d0ccb35d7fb439f8178e08e9f0b42a652a2b102a76dbb0ad63
1 Input
1 Output
-
3393624810d8b6d0ccb35d7fb439f8178e08e9f0b42a652a2b102a76dbb0ad63:0
- value
- 25997379
- script pubkey
- OP_0 OP_PUSHBYTES_20 159ad35d19db3d7cc41257bb9570c02df457681e
- address
- bc1qzkddxhgemv7he3qj27ae2uxq9h69w6q7llf9ux